Sound Quality Factors
Sound quality plays a key role in choosing the loudest Bluetooth speaker for your car. It affects how clear and rich your music sounds. Understanding sound quality factors helps pick the best speaker for your needs.
Frequency Range
The frequency range shows the spectrum of sounds a speaker can produce. A wider range means the speaker can play both low and high sounds well. Look for speakers with a range from about 20 Hz to 20 kHz for full sound coverage.
Bass Performance
Bass gives music depth and power. Strong bass makes songs feel more alive and exciting. Good bass performance depends on the speaker’s size and design. Speakers with dedicated bass drivers often deliver better low tones.
Speaker Drivers And Configuration
Speaker drivers are the parts that create sound. Larger drivers usually produce louder and clearer sound. Multi-driver setups separate bass, midrange, and treble sounds. This design improves overall sound clarity and balance.

Placement Inside The Car
Where you place the speaker affects sound quality. Put the speaker on a flat surface to avoid vibrations. Avoid placing it near windows or doors to reduce sound loss. Center placement works well to spread sound evenly. Keep the speaker away from objects that block sound waves.
Using Equalizer Settings
Adjust the equalizer on your device for better sound. Boost mid and high frequencies for clearer vocals and instruments. Lower bass slightly to avoid distortion at high volumes. Experiment with settings to match your music type. Save your favorite settings for quick use.
Reducing Background Noise
Background noise reduces sound clarity. Close windows and doors while playing music. Turn off fans or air conditioners nearby. Use noise-canceling features on your speaker if available. Cleaner sound helps you hear details better, even at high volume.

Bluetooth Version And Range
Bluetooth version affects sound quality and connection strength. Newer versions use less power and give better sound. They also keep a stable connection over longer distances. A good car speaker should support at least Bluetooth 4.2 or higher. This helps avoid dropouts while driving. Check the range too. Most car speakers work well within 30 feet.
Multi-device Pairing
Multi-device pairing lets you connect more than one device. This feature is handy if you share the car. Different people can play music from their phones. Some speakers switch quickly between devices. This saves time and makes sharing easy. Look for speakers that support two or more devices at once.
Auxiliary And Usb Options
Auxiliary (AUX) and USB ports add extra ways to connect. AUX lets you plug in devices without Bluetooth. USB ports can charge your phone or play music from a flash drive. These options come in handy if Bluetooth fails. They also allow use with older devices. Choose a speaker with at least one of these ports.

Maintenance And Care
Maintaining your loudest Bluetooth speaker for your car keeps the sound clear and strong. Proper care helps the speaker last longer and perform better. Simple steps can protect your investment and improve your listening experience.
Cleaning Tips
Dust and dirt can block the speaker’s sound. Use a soft cloth to wipe the outside regularly. Avoid using water or cleaning sprays directly on the speaker. Use a small brush to clean speaker grills gently. Keep the speaker away from food and liquids in the car.
Battery Maintenance
Charge the speaker fully before first use. Do not let the battery drain completely often. Charge it regularly, even if you don’t use it daily. Avoid charging the speaker overnight to protect battery health. Store the speaker in a cool, dry place to keep the battery safe.
Software Updates
Check for software updates from the speaker’s brand. Updates fix bugs and improve sound quality. Use the official app or website for updates. Update the speaker regularly to keep it working well. Follow the instructions carefully during the update process.
